When one of you meets his brother, let him greet him with peace. If a tree, a wall, or a rock comes between them and then he meets him again, let him greet him with peace once more.Muawiya said, Abdul-Wahhab bin Bakht also narrated to me from Abu Zinad, from Araj, from Abu Hurairah, from the Messenger of Allah ﷺ the rider greets the one walking.

Sourcing, [sahih] Bukhari narrated it in Adab al-Mufrad, no. 1010, from the hadith of Muawiya bin Salih through the same chain, but he did not mention Abu Musa in the chain, and this Abu Musa is unknown. It has corroborating narrations with Ibn Sunni in Amal al-Yawm wal-Layla, no. 245, and Tabarani in al-Awsat, no. 7983, and others. See Nayl al-Maqsud 3/1078.
